The Ibis Hotel (Hami G312 National Road Branch) is located at 71 Dongjiang Middle Avenue, Chekou Automobile Industry Park, Hami City, on the side of G312 National Road; Ibis is a global hotel brand created by Accor Group in France, with a history of over 40 years. It is a ranked chain hotel brand in Europe. After the alliance between Huazhu Group and Accor Group in 2015, with the joint cooperation of the two hotel groups, Ibis has been recognized by Chinese customers for its international quality, credibility, and new fashionable accommodation experience. The hotel is 12 kilometers away from Hami Yizhou Airport and 4.5 kilometers away from the train station; 7.6 kilometers away from Huijia Times Square; Adjacent to the second-hand car market, car scrap company, and Red Star Hospital of the 13th Division of the Xinjiang Production and Construction Corps; Supermarkets and restaurants are readily available around the hotel.
